Springboot相关问题

在运行springboot时,打出Autowired之后,下面的programme就显示了红色波浪线,根据网上的教程调低了报错级别之后出现如下问题,个人不知道如何解决。

img

启动报错,是因为ProgrammeDao对应的实现类(ProgrammeDaoImpl)没有注册到spring上下文里面,你看看这个问题,解决这个之后就好了

没要找到对应dao的bean 也就是dao没交给IOC管理

img

一是你可以用@Resource来代替@Autowired ,二是对应的dao层(持久层)加上注解@Repository